The workshop on "Using Artificial Intelligence to Serve Arab Culture" kicked off on May 6, 2025, in the United Arab Emirates. The event is organized by the Arab League Educational, Cultural and Scientific Organization (ALECSO) in collaboration with the UAE National Commission for Education, Culture, and Science, and is being held at the Ajman Cultural Center in the Emirate of Ajman. It features the participation of prominent experts and specialists in artificial intelligence and cultural fields.
The opening session started by welcoming remarks offered by H.E. Ms. Ebtesam Alzaabi, Secretary-General of the UAE National Commission, followed by a speech by H.E. Dr. Mohamed Ould Amar, Director-General of ALECSO, delivered on his behalf by Dr. Mohamed Jemni, Director of ICT. The speech highlighted the importance of harnessing AI to enhance the presence of Arab culture in the digital era, and the need to invest in innovation to serve heritage and cultural identity.
The first day featured a series of presentations, beginning with an introductory lecture on "Artificial Intelligence and its Cultural Applications", delivered by Dr. Mohamed Jemni, in which he highlighted the latest AI technologies and their potential applications in the cultural field.
Dr. Mourad Sakli, Culture Expert at ALECSO, spoke about “The Impact of Technology on Cultural and Artistic Production".
Dr. Samia Chelbi, AI Expert at ALECSO, made a presentation on “Artificial Intelligence in Films and Interactive Games”, in which she highlighted global experiences and new possibilities for cultural interaction.
Dr. Ashraf Darwish offered a paper entitled “The Evolution of Artificial Intelligence and Its Impact on Culture: Opportunities and Challenges”.
The presentations were followed by an open discussion.
The first day of the workshop saw the presence of 40 participants, including experts and specialists in artificial intelligence and culture, along with representatives from cultural and academic institutions.
The workshop reflects a joint effort to digitize culture and develop innovative tools to preserve Arab heritage.
